Abstract :
This paper presents the computation properties of an asynchronous spike event coding scheme employed for communicating signals between analog blocks in a programmable array. The computation is intrinsic to the spike event communication scheme and is performed without additional hardware. The ability of the communication scheme to perform computation will enhance the computation power of the programmable analog array. Test results from a chip implemented using 0.35 μm CMOS technology are presented.
